Resume.bz
Nghề Nghiệp Phát Triển & Kỹ Thuật

Nhà phát triển Java

Phát triển sự nghiệp của bạn với vai trò Nhà phát triển Java.

Xây dựng các ứng dụng động bằng Java, thúc đẩy sự đổi mới trong phát triển phần mềm

Phát triển logic phía server cho các ứng dụng web và doanh nghiệp sử dụng Java.Tích hợp cơ sở dữ liệu và API để đảm bảo luồng dữ liệu liền mạch và hiệu suất.Tối ưu hóa mã nguồn để mở rộng quy mô, xử lý hơn 10.000 người dùng đồng thời trong môi trường sản xuất.
Tổng quan

Xây dựng cái nhìn chuyên gia vềvai trò Nhà phát triển Java

Xây dựng các ứng dụng động bằng Java, thúc đẩy sự đổi mới trong phát triển phần mềm. Thiết kế, mã hóa và bảo trì các hệ thống backend có khả năng mở rộng sử dụng các framework Java. Hợp tác với các nhóm đa chức năng để cung cấp các giải pháp phần mềm mạnh mẽ, hiệu quả.

Tổng quan

Nghề Nghiệp Phát Triển & Kỹ Thuật

Ảnh chụp vai trò

Xây dựng các ứng dụng động bằng Java, thúc đẩy sự đổi mới trong phát triển phần mềm

Chỉ số thành công

Những gì nhà tuyển dụng mong đợi

  • Phát triển logic phía server cho các ứng dụng web và doanh nghiệp sử dụng Java.
  • Tích hợp cơ sở dữ liệu và API để đảm bảo luồng dữ liệu liền mạch và hiệu suất.
  • Tối ưu hóa mã nguồn để mở rộng quy mô, xử lý hơn 10.000 người dùng đồng thời trong môi trường sản xuất.
  • Thực hiện đánh giá mã nguồn và gỡ lỗi để duy trì tiêu chuẩn uptime 99%.
  • Triển khai các giao thức bảo mật, giảm lỗ hổng 40% thông qua các thực hành tốt nhất.
Cách trở thành Nhà phát triển Java

Hành trình từng bước để trở thànhmột Lập kế hoạch phát triển Nhà phát triển Java của bạn nổi bật

1

Nắm vững nền tảng Java

Xây dựng nền tảng vững chắc về cú pháp Java, nguyên tắc OOP và các thư viện cốt lõi qua các dự án thực hành.

2

Tích lũy kinh nghiệm thực tế

Đóng góp vào các dự án Java mã nguồn mở hoặc thực tập, triển khai ứng dụng để xử lý dữ liệu thực tế.

3

Học các framework và công cụ

Nghiên cứu Spring Boot, Hibernate và Maven; xây dựng ứng dụng portfolio tích hợp nhiều thành phần.

4

Theo đuổi chứng chỉ

Đạt chứng chỉ Oracle Certified Java Programmer để xác thực kỹ năng và tăng cơ hội việc làm.

Bản đồ kỹ năng

Kỹ năng khiến nhà tuyển dụng nói “có”

Lớp các điểm mạnh này vào sơ yếu lý lịch, danh mục và phỏng vấn để thể hiện sự sẵn sàng.

Điểm mạnh cốt lõi
Lập trình Java và thiết kế hướng đối tượngSpring Framework cho dependency injectionPhát triển và tích hợp RESTful APIQuản lý cơ sở dữ liệu với SQL và JPAKiểm thử đơn vị với JUnit và MockitoQuản lý phiên bản sử dụng Git workflowsPhương pháp Agile và tham gia ScrumGiải quyết vấn đề cho các nút thắt hiệu suất
Bộ công cụ kỹ thuật
Maven và Gradle cho tự động hóa buildDocker containerization cho triển khaiCấu hình pipeline CI/CD với JenkinsThiết kế kiến trúc microservices
Thành tựu có thể chuyển giao
Hợp tác nhóm trong môi trường đa chức năngGiao tiếp hiệu quả các khái niệm kỹ thuậtQuản lý thời gian cho các sprint lặp lạiKhả năng thích ứng với các tech stack đang phát triển
Giáo dục & công cụ

Xây dựng ngăn xếp học tập của bạn

Lộ trình học tập

Thường yêu cầu bằng cử nhân Khoa học Máy tính hoặc lĩnh vực liên quan, tập trung vào lập trình và nguyên tắc kỹ thuật phần mềm.

  • Cử nhân Khoa học Máy tính từ trường đại học được công nhận
  • Cao đẳng chuyên ngành Phát triển Phần mềm với trọng tâm Java
  • Chương trình bootcamp chuyên sâu về full-stack Java
  • Tự học qua các nền tảng trực tuyến như Coursera và Udemy
  • Thạc sĩ Kỹ thuật Phần mềm cho các vai trò nâng cao

Chứng chỉ nổi bật

Oracle Certified Professional Java SE ProgrammerSpring Professional CertificationAWS Certified Developer - AssociateGoogle Cloud Professional DeveloperMicrosoft Certified: Azure Developer AssociateIBM Certified Application Developer

Công cụ nhà tuyển dụng mong đợi

IntelliJ IDEA cho chỉnh sửa mãEclipse IDE cho phát triển JavaMaven cho quản lý buildGradle cho xử lý dependencyGit cho quản lý phiên bảnDocker cho containerizationJenkins cho pipeline CI/CDPostman cho kiểm thử APIJIRA cho theo dõi nhiệm vụ
LinkedIn & chuẩn bị phỏng vấn

Kể câu chuyện của bạn tự tin trực tuyến và trực tiếp

Sử dụng các gợi ý này để đánh bóng định vị của bạn và giữ bình tĩnh dưới áp lực phỏng vấn.

Ý tưởng tiêu đề LinkedIn

Hồ sơ thể hiện chuyên môn Java, portfolio dự án và thành tựu hợp tác trong đổi mới phần mềm.

Tóm tắt LinkedIn About

Nhà phát triển Java đam mê với hơn 5 năm kinh nghiệm xây dựng hệ thống backend mạnh mẽ. Xuất sắc trong Spring Framework, tích hợp API và tối ưu hóa cho môi trường lưu lượng cao. Đã chứng minh khả năng giảm độ trễ 30% qua mã nguồn hiệu quả. Đang tìm kiếm cơ hội thúc đẩy các giải pháp phần mềm đổi mới trong các đội ngũ năng động.

Mẹo tối ưu hóa LinkedIn

  • Nhấn mạnh tác động định lượng như 'Cải thiện hiệu suất ứng dụng 25% sử dụng chiến lược caching.'
  • Bao gồm liên kết GitHub đến các dự án Java thể hiện ứng dụng thực tế.
  • Kết nối với cộng đồng Java và chia sẻ bài viết về các framework mới nổi.
  • Sử dụng endorsements cho kỹ năng như Spring Boot để xây dựng uy tín.
  • Tùy chỉnh tóm tắt để nhấn mạnh hợp tác trong môi trường Agile.

Từ khóa nổi bật

JavaSpring BootMicroservicesREST APIBackend DevelopmentJPA HibernateAgile ScrumDocker KubernetesCI/CD JenkinsOracle Java Certification
Chuẩn bị phỏng vấn

Làm chủ phản hồi phỏng vấn của bạn

Chuẩn bị các câu chuyện ngắn gọn, tập trung vào tác động để làm nổi bật thành tựu và quyết định của bạn.

01
Câu hỏi

Giải thích cách bạn thiết kế RESTful API sử dụng Spring Boot cho xác thực người dùng.

02
Câu hỏi

Mô tả cách tối ưu hóa ứng dụng Java để xử lý 50.000 giao dịch hàng ngày.

03
Câu hỏi

Bạn triển khai kiểm thử đơn vị trong dự án Java với JUnit như thế nào?

04
Câu hỏi

Hướng dẫn qua quá trình giải quyết rò rỉ bộ nhớ trong ứng dụng Java sản xuất.

05
Câu hỏi

Thảo luận về việc tích hợp backend Java với cơ sở dữ liệu quan hệ sử dụng JPA.

06
Câu hỏi

Các chiến lược nào đảm bảo thực hành mã hóa an toàn trong ứng dụng web Java?

Công việc & lối sống

Thiết kế ngày thường như bạn mong muốn

Bao gồm mã hóa hợp tác trong các đội Agile, cân bằng các sprint phát triển với đánh giá mã; mô hình làm việc từ xa hoặc lai phổ biến, với tuần làm việc 40 giờ tập trung vào giao hàng lặp lại.

Mẹo lối sống

Ưu tiên stand-up hàng ngày để đồng bộ mục tiêu sprint và các trở ngại.

Mẹo lối sống

Sử dụng pair programming để tăng tốc học tập và chất lượng mã.

Mẹo lối sống

Duy trì cân bằng công việc-cuộc sống bằng cách đặt giới hạn trong ca trực.

Mẹo lối sống

Tận dụng công cụ như Slack cho giao tiếp nhóm nhanh chóng.

Mẹo lối sống

Lập lịch thời gian cho học tập liên tục giữa các hạn chót dự án.

Mục tiêu nghề nghiệp

Lập bản đồ thành tựu ngắn hạn và dài hạn

Tiến bộ từ mã hóa junior đến lãnh đạo kiến trúc, đóng góp vào các hệ thống có khả năng mở rộng hỗ trợ tăng trưởng kinh doanh và đổi mới công nghệ.

Tập trung ngắn hạn
  • Nắm vững Spring Boot để dẫn dắt phát triển module backend trong 6 tháng.
  • Đóng góp vào 3 dự án Java mã nguồn mở để nâng cao portfolio.
  • Đạt chứng chỉ Oracle Java để đủ điều kiện cho vai trò cao cấp.
  • Tối ưu hóa ứng dụng hiện tại, nhắm đến cải thiện hiệu suất 20%.
Quỹ đạo dài hạn
  • Kiến trúc hệ thống Java cấp doanh nghiệp xử lý hàng triệu người dùng.
  • Dẫn dắt đội phát triển áp dụng kiến trúc microservices.
  • Theo đuổi bằng sáng chế hoặc ấn phẩm liên quan Java trong thiết kế phần mềm.
  • Chuyển sang vị trí trưởng kỹ thuật hoặc kiến trúc sư giải pháp.
Lập kế hoạch phát triển Nhà phát triển Java của bạn | Resume.bz – Resume.bz